Transaction 20d7d1e0fcc66f1e6929c98440fd1b91c85e7a081cb9a53872a2449b189b3717

1 Input
1 Outputs
  • 20d7d1e0fcc66f1e6929c98440fd1b91c85e7a081cb9a53872a2449b189b3717:0
  • value  751603
    address  3NKNsqKcCut9RQKQjH1fV4rbxnbRx3KSai